A 25 kW wireless charger design for electric vehicles is presented in this paper. The wireless charger consist of three phase power factor corrector (PFC), three phase resonant inverter, primary and secondary coils with series resonant compensation, and a rectifier. Magnetically coupled resonant (MCR) wireless power transfer (WPT) technology is efficient and practical for mid-range wireless energy transmission. For the design of MCR WPT system, it is necessary to seek optimal transmission performance under different applications. Concentric coils are used in domestic induction heating system to improve the range of cookware sizes suitable to be heated up because the coils are switched on or switched off depending on the degree of their covering by the pot.
